Lawsuit indicates a cover up attempt at City Hall The city of Miami code compliance supervisor who was confronted and allegedly poked and pushed by Commissioner Alex Diaz de la Portilla at an illegal nightclub in February has sued the lawmaker for libel and is seeking more than $100,000 in damages. The rain Sunday didn’t dampen the early voting crowd in Coral Gables as much as Ladra thought it would. There were almost as many voters as on Saturday, for a total of 1,554 ballots cast at the Coral Gables library.
